  61. /** inet_connection_sock - INET connection oriented sock
  62. *
  63. * @icsk_accept_queue: FIFO of established children
  64. * @icsk_bind_hash: Bind node
  65. * @icsk_timeout: Timeout
  66. * @icsk_retransmit_timer: Resend (no ack)
  67. * @icsk_rto: Retransmit timeout
  68. * @icsk_pmtu_cookie Last pmtu seen by socket
  69. * @icsk_ca_ops Pluggable congestion control hook
  70. * @icsk_af_ops Operations which are AF_INET{4,6} specific
  71. * @icsk_ca_state: Congestion control state
  72. * @icsk_retransmits: Number of unrecovered [RTO] timeouts
  73. * @icsk_pending: Scheduled timer event
  74. * @icsk_backoff: Backoff
  75. * @icsk_syn_retries: Number of allowed SYN (or equivalent) retries
  76. * @icsk_probes_out: unanswered 0 window probes
  77. * @icsk_ext_hdr_len: Network protocol overhead (IP/IPv6 options)
  78. * @icsk_ack: Delayed ACK control data
  79. * @icsk_mtup; MTU probing control data
  80. */
  81. struct inet_connection_sock {
  82. /* inet_sock has to be the first member! */
  83. struct inet_sock icsk_inet;
  84. struct request_sock_queue icsk_accept_queue;
  85. struct inet_bind_bucket *icsk_bind_hash;
  86. unsigned long icsk_timeout;
  87. struct timer_list icsk_retransmit_timer;
  88. struct timer_list icsk_delack_timer;
  89. __u32 icsk_rto;
  90. __u32 icsk_pmtu_cookie;
  91. const struct tcp_congestion_ops *icsk_ca_ops;
  92. const struct inet_connection_sock_af_ops *icsk_af_ops;
  93. unsigned int (*icsk_sync_mss)(struct sock *sk, u32 pmtu);
  94. __u8 icsk_ca_state:6,
  95. icsk_ca_setsockopt:1,
  96. icsk_ca_dst_locked:1;
  97. __u8 icsk_retransmits;
  98. __u8 icsk_pending;
  99. __u8 icsk_backoff;
  100. __u8 icsk_syn_retries;
  101. __u8 icsk_probes_out;
  102. __u16 icsk_ext_hdr_len;
  103. struct {
  104. __u8 pending; /* ACK is pending */
  105. __u8 quick; /* Scheduled number of quick acks */
  106. __u8 pingpong; /* The session is interactive */
  107. __u8 blocked; /* Delayed ACK was blocked by socket lock */
  108. __u32 ato; /* Predicted tick of soft clock */
  109. unsigned long timeout; /* Currently scheduled timeout */
  110. __u32 lrcvtime; /* timestamp of last received data packet */
  111. __u16 last_seg_size; /* Size of last incoming segment */
  112. __u16 rcv_mss; /* MSS used for delayed ACK decisions */
  113. } icsk_ack;
  114. struct {
  115. int enabled;
  116. /* Range of MTUs to search */
  117. int search_high;
  118. int search_low;
  119. /* Information on the current probe. */
  120. int probe_size;
  121. u32 probe_timestamp;
  122. } icsk_mtup;
  123. u32 icsk_user_timeout;
  124. u64 icsk_ca_priv[64 / sizeof(u64)];
  125. #define ICSK_CA_PRIV_SIZE (8 * sizeof(u64))
  126. };
